About Feldsalat

Feldsalat, also known as lamb's lettuce, mâche, or corn salad, is a leafy green with delicate, nutty-flavored leaves. Native to Europe, it's a staple in German, French, and Swiss cuisines, often used in fresh salads or as a garnish. Nutritionally, Feldsalat is a powerhouse, rich in vitamins A, C, and K, as well as folate and iron. It’s also a good source of antioxidants, which support immune health and combat oxidative stress. Low in calories and high in water content, it’s an excellent choice for those aiming to maintain a healthy weight. Feldsalat is mild on the stomach and easily digestible, making it a versatile option for various diets. It’s often paired with ingredients like nuts, seeds, or citrus dressings to enhance its flavor and nutritional profile. Avoid overdressing, as the delicate leaves can wilt quickly, and opt for fresh, untreated greens for the best health benefits.
